Discovering the Allure of the 1957 Bel Air

The 1957 Bel Air represents the pinnacle of Chevrolet's "Tri-Five" era, a period of significant design innovation and popularity. Its distinctive "tailfins," wraparound windshield, and the "Bel Air” script nameplate became synonymous with mid-century American optimism and style. Why the 1957 Bel Air Remains a Top Classic Car Choice

Several factors contribute to the enduring appeal of the 1957 Bel Air:

  • Iconic Design: Its aggressive yet elegant lines are timeless. The car’s silhouette is instantly identifiable.
  • Performance Options: Available with powerful V8 engines, it offered a blend of style and performance that appealed to a wide audience.
  • Cultural Significance: Featured in countless movies, TV shows, and songs, the '57 Chevy is deeply embedded in American popular culture.
  • Collectibility: Its status as a "collector's item" ensures strong resale value and continued interest from enthusiasts.

What to Consider When Buying a 1957 Bel Air

Purchasing a classic car is a significant investment. Beyond the price tag, several critical factors need thorough evaluation.

Condition and Restoration Status

Cars will vary significantly in their condition:

  • Project Cars: These require extensive work and are best suited for experienced mechanics or those with a significant budget for restoration.
  • Driver Quality: These cars are generally in good running order, perhaps with some cosmetic flaws or older restorations. They are perfect for enjoying on the road.
  • Show Quality: These are typically immaculately restored or highly original cars, often with concours-level attention to detail. They command the highest prices.

Originality vs. Modifications

  • Original: Maintains factory specifications, which is often preferred by purists and can affect value.
  • Modified: May have upgraded engines, transmissions, suspension, or modern features. These can offer improved drivability but might be less desirable to certain collectors.

Documentation and History

Look for comprehensive documentation:

  • Build Sheets and Original Paperwork: If available, these add significant value and authenticity.
  • Restoration Records: Photos and receipts from past restorations provide insight into the work done.
  • Ownership History: A clear chain of ownership can add confidence.

Budgeting for Your 1957 Bel Air Purchase

Prices for a 1957 Bel Air for sale can range dramatically. Factors influencing cost include condition, originality, rarity of options, and provenance.

Typical Price Ranges

  • Project Cars: Can start from $5,000 - $15,000, depending on how complete they are.
  • Driver Quality: Typically range from $20,000 - $40,000.
  • Show Quality/Concours: Often exceed $50,000 and can reach well into the six figures for exceptional examples.

Additional Costs to Factor In

Remember to budget for:

  • Transportation: Shipping a classic car can be expensive.
  • Inspection: Hiring a pre-purchase inspector is highly recommended.
  • Taxes and Fees: Registration, sales tax, and potential import duties.
  • Immediate Maintenance: Even a good car might need immediate attention.
